Questions 23 and 24 pertain to the following situation. From 2004 to 2013, the average salary, y, in thousands of dollars, for public school teachers for the year t can be modeled by the equation y = 33.374 + 9.162 In t, where t is the number of years since 2000 (i.e, t = 4 represents 2004 and so on). %3D 23. According to the model, what was the average salary for public school teachers in 2017? 24. According to the model, dùring which year did the average salary for public school teachers reach $50,000?
